What Is GEO and Why Does It Matter for Remodelers?

GEO stands for Generative Engine Optimization — the practice of structuring your content, citations, and authority signals so that large language models (LLMs) confidently recommend your business when someone asks an AI assistant for a remodeling contractor. Traditional SEO gets you onto a Google results page. GEO gets you named in the answer itself.

When a homeowner near the Hall of Fame Village corridor types “best kitchen remodeler in Canton Ohio” into ChatGPT or asks Google’s AI Overview for a recommendation, the AI pulls from a web of structured data, reviews, authoritative mentions, and schema markup — not just keyword rankings. If your business isn’t woven into that web, you don’t exist in the AI’s world, even if you’ve been remodeling Canton homes for 20 years.

Why Most Remodeling Websites Fail in AI Search

The average remodeling website was built to look good on a monitor, not to communicate with a machine. LLMs make recommendations by synthesizing structured signals: schema markup, consistent NAP (name, address, phone) data, review velocity, topical authority, and third-party citations from sources the AI already trusts. Most contractor sites are missing several of these layers entirely.

No Schema Markup

Without structured data — LocalBusiness schema, Service schema, FAQPage schema — AI models have to guess what your business does and where. They often guess wrong, or simply skip you in favor of a competitor with cleaner data architecture.

Thin Location Content

A single “Service Areas” page that lists Massillon, Alliance, and Akron without any meaningful local content tells an AI nothing useful. GEO-optimized pages answer the specific questions Canton-area homeowners actually ask, written at a depth that signals genuine expertise.

Weak Citation Footprint

LLMs learn about local businesses from the broader web — directory listings, news mentions, industry publications, review platforms. A sparse citation footprint is invisible territory. GEO experts build that footprint systematically.

What a GEO Expert Actually Does for Your Remodeling Company

Hiring a GEO specialist isn’t the same as hiring an SEO generalist and hoping for the best. The work is distinct and requires fluency in how AI models are trained to evaluate trustworthiness and relevance. Here’s what a dedicated GEO engagement looks like for a Canton remodeler.

Entity Building

Your business needs to exist as a clearly defined “entity” in the knowledge graph — a recognizable, well-described organization with consistent attributes across the web. GEO experts audit and correct every touchpoint: Google Business Profile, Bing Places, Yelp, Houzz, HomeAdvisor, local Stark County chamber listings, and more.

Topical Authority Development

AI tools favor businesses that demonstrate deep knowledge of their trade. That means creating content clusters around the specific remodeling questions Canton homeowners ask — financing options for older homes near West Tuscarawas Street, permit requirements through the City of Canton Building Department, or the best siding materials for Ohio’s freeze-thaw cycles. Each piece strengthens your AI footprint.

Review Velocity and Sentiment Optimization

AI Overviews and LLMs heavily weight review data. A GEO expert builds a systematic review acquisition process and helps you respond to existing reviews in ways that reinforce key service and location signals — subtly, naturally, and without violating platform policies.

Frequently Asked Questions About GEO for Canton Remodelers

What does GEO stand for and how is it different from SEO?

GEO stands for Generative Engine Optimization. While SEO focuses on ranking in traditional search engine results pages, GEO focuses on being recommended by AI-powered tools like ChatGPT, Google AI Overviews, and Bing Copilot. Both matter, but GEO addresses the newer layer of AI-assisted discovery that SEO alone doesn’t cover.
